Output 02663bbda307833a69f2e86476ef8cc0d7525f623ecb4e982c20679d26218efd:0

value
635401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 689d2658f6b1370ada72da4a8345a04cafa5abb2 OP_EQUAL
address
3BEATTF8tiiPgeiHwXuBhUKbXZ1h99Gemt
transaction
02663bbda307833a69f2e86476ef8cc0d7525f623ecb4e982c20679d26218efd
confirmations
272810
spent
true